The Summer Program in Biostatistics and Computational Biology is excited to host its program on campus this year!

The program, intended for undergraduate students and recent grads that are underrepresented in graduate education, provides a unique opportunity to learn about the use of quantitative methods for biological, environmental, and medical research alongside Harvard faculty, researchers, and graduate students.

Deadline to Apply: February 17, 2023.
